Output ecef3020b2d5836083cebc629a4a1b5f4648b3c98ca5495cbd96a391b585861e:23

value
338903218
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a473be7efcd68d8d50412b55df5108c435f26b82 OP_EQUAL
address
3GgZQ3fWTE6fcuZVTiho26q2XzpiZdB1ZH
transaction
ecef3020b2d5836083cebc629a4a1b5f4648b3c98ca5495cbd96a391b585861e
spent
true